Signs of Oral Emergency Situations
Identifying the indicators of dental emergency situations is important for timely action and correct therapy. If you experience severe tooth pain that's constant and pain, it might suggest an underlying problem that requires prompt attention.
Swelling in the gum tissues, face, or jaw can likewise signify an oral emergency, especially if it's accompanied by pain or high temperature. Any type of sort of injury to the mouth resulting in a cracked, broken, or knocked-out tooth must be treated as an emergency to stop additional damage and prospective infection.
Bleeding from visit the following page that does not quit after using stress for a few mins is another warning that you should look for emergency oral care. In addition, if you observe any indications of infection such as pus, a nasty preference in your mouth, or a fever, it's important to see a dental professional as soon as possible.
Disregarding these indications could bring about more serious complications, so it's vital to act promptly when confronted with a prospective oral emergency.
